Anthropic has released Claude Fable 5.1 and Claude Mythos 5.1, three months after the Fable 5 line shipped in June 2026. The two are the same underlying model behind different safeguard layers. Fable 5.1 is generally available as claude-fable-5-1 ; Mythos 5.1 stays restricted to vetted organizations. Both carry a 1M token context window and 128K max output tokens, with adaptive thinking always on. The headline capability number is 52.6% on Terminal-Bench-Science 0.1, against 24.7% for Fable 5 and 29.0% for Opus 5. The headline commercial number is a 75% cut to cache reads, from $1.00 to $0.25 per million tokens, which Anthropic measures as roughly 25% lower cost on typical workloads and up to 45% on agentic ones. Base input and output pricing is unchanged at $10 and $50 per million.

On Terminal-Bench-Science 0.1, an agentic scientific research benchmark, Fable 5.1 scores 52.6% against 29.0% for Opus 5, 24.7% for Fable 5, and 22.4% for GPT-5.6 Sol. Anthropic reports a standard error of 3.5 to 4.5 points per model, so treat the margin, not the ranking, with care.

On Terminal-Bench 4.0, Fable 5.1 reaches 55.8% and Mythos 5.1 reaches 60.9%. The gap between two identical models is the cost of safeguard interventions, which is an unusually honest disclosure. Elsewhere: CursorBench 3.2.0 at 73.4%, Humanity’s Last Exam at 60.9% without tools and 65.0% with tools, AutomationBench at 31.4%, OSWorld 2.0 at 41.7% strict, and GDPval-AA v2 at 1853.

Base input and output pricing is unchanged. Cache reads drop 75%, from $1.00 to $0.25 per million tokens, which is 0.025 times base input against 0.1 on every other Claude model. Anthropic measures roughly 25% lower cost on typical workloads and up to about 45% on context-heavy agentic ones. Batch processing is $5 and $25 per million tokens.

Additive changes: per-message effort, turn-scoped system messages, and thinking.display: "updates" are all in beta behind headers. Content provenance is not optional, with a statistical text watermark on all output and C2PA credentials on files.

Anthropic also documents real regressions. Parallel tool calling is more variable, so agent loops may issue one call per turn where Fable 5 batched several. The model narrates less, answers from memory more often at low effort, and prefers whole-file rewrites over targeted edits.

Cyber safeguards now permit vulnerability discovery but not exploit development, cutting interventions in Claude Code by roughly 60% per session. Biology safeguards fire 85% less often on benign requests. Penetration testing, exploit generation, and binary-based vulnerability scanning still redirect to Opus.

On research, Mythos 5.1 designed protein binders with roughly 50% hit rate across 12 targets against a 10 to 15% norm, Fable 5.1 built a Venus elevation map:https://zenodo.org/records/22164484 at 2 to 3 km resolution, and custom GPU kernels sped up seven open-source genomics models by up to 2.5x.
